Union Square

neighborhood guide

While often compared to Times Square for its convenience as a commuter hub and the multitude of activities in Union Square Park, this area exudes far more charm, and its central location, bordered by Chelsea, Gramercy Park, and Greenwich Village, only adds to the allure. Many buildings ringing the park are historic landmarks, often occupied by young families and students from NYU and The New School. The legendary farmers market offers produce destined for many of the neighborhood's eateries, and shoulder-to-shoulder shops on Fifth Avenue have created a convenient retail corridor, while a district of home design stores and showrooms has sprung up on the side streets.
